Every dollar raised at the Kawartha Tri-Sport Tournament goes directly to local charities. Since 2016, we've contributed more than $368,000 to organizations making a real difference.

The tournament's giving has expanded year after year. The timeline below highlights recent beneficiary classes and listed allocations, with additional partner organizations represented in the archive below.
Latest listed allocations
2025
2 listed gifts · $60,000
The 2025 giving timeline currently includes a $30,000 gift for the Down Syndrome Foundation and a $30,000 gift for Five Counties Children’s Centre.

Beneficiary class
2024
5 organizations · $72,000
A single tournament year funded care, childhood rehabilitation, community play, family support, and Huntington disease advocacy.

2024 Beneficiary
Hearts 4 Joy
Supporting families and individuals in the Peterborough area with programs that bring joy, connection, and hope to those facing challenging circumstances.

2024 Beneficiary
Hospice Peterborough
Providing compassionate end-of-life care and bereavement support to individuals and families in Peterborough and the surrounding region.

2024 Beneficiary
Five Counties Children’s Centre
Delivering rehabilitation and support services to children and youth with physical, communication, and developmental needs across five counties.

2024 Beneficiary
Ennismore Inclusive Playground
Building an accessible, inclusive playground at the Ennismore Waterfront Park so children of all abilities can play together.

2024 Beneficiary
Huntington Society of Canada
Supporting the Peterborough chapter in its mission to improve the quality of life for those affected by Huntington disease.
